Jumbo loans: Big homes, big loans, big benefits
If you’re looking to finance high-end real estate in Pacific Palisades, a jumbo loan is probably the first option to consider. Jumbo loans are designed for homes that are too expensive for conventional mortgages, and are traditionally used for financing luxury properties.
Jumbo loans come with loan amounts that exceed the conforming limits set by the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A). In most areas, the 2024 maximum loan limit for a conventional mortgage is $766,550, but in Los Angeles County where Pacific Palisades belongs, the conforming limit is $1,149,825.
For instance, if you’re purchasing a $4 million home, this surpasses the conforming loan limits set by the FHFA, making a jumbo loan the appropriate choice. Here’s what you need to know:
- Bigger down payments: Lenders often require at least 20% down, which is $800,000 on a $4 million home.
- Higher credit standards: Jumbo loans require a high credit score, usually around 700 or higher, as lenders want to ensure borrowers are financially capable to pay back the significant loan amounts.
- Competitive rates: Jumbo loans may come with a higher interest rate, but a strong financial profile and a good relationship with your lender can help you secure a more competitive rate. In some cases, the rates may be similar to those of conventional loans.
Jumbo loans allow you to buy a high-end property without draining your savings or selling off other investments. In fact, many high-net-worth individuals use jumbo loans to maintain liquidity, keeping their portfolios intact while securing a new asset. If you have a robust investment portfolio earning solid returns, keeping those investments growing may make more sense than pulling out a large sum to pay for the house upfront.
Portfolio loans: A custom fit for your finances
A portfolio loan could be the way to go if your financial situation is more complex, such as when you own several businesses or have a varied income stream. These loans are kept on the lender’s books, meaning they aren’t sold to the secondary market, giving lenders the flexibility to work with you directly on customized terms.
A portfolio loan is particularly helpful if you don’t fit the typical borrower profile. For instance, you might be a business owner with irregular income or an investor who earns through different channels. In these cases, traditional income verification might not reflect your actual wealth, and that’s where a portfolio loan can come in handy. Since the lender keeps the loan in-house, they can offer creative solutions that suit your financial situation.
For example, if you’re a tech entrepreneur, you may have a substantial net worth but much of your income comes from investments and business profits, which vary from year to year. The standard requirements for a conventional mortgage might not accurately reflect your total assets or the income you actually make. A portfolio loan can be tailored to fit your unique financial situation. Instead of focusing solely on your annual income, the lender may look at your overall assets, business holdings, and investment portfolio to determine the loan amount and terms to offer you.
Here are the main advantages of portfolio loans:
- Flexible terms: The lender can adjust the loan terms to fit your unique financial situation. Whether you’re looking for a lower down payment or interest rate options, portfolio loans offer more room to negotiate.
- Asset-based qualifying: If you have significant assets but don’t meet traditional mortgage criteria, an asset-based mortgage (also known as an asset-qualifier mortgage) might be a suitable option. This type of portfolio loan allows you to qualify primarily based on your assets rather than your income. For example, if you’re retired, funds in your IRA, 401(k), or other retirement accounts can be used to secure the mortgage. Additionally, other assets such as real estate, cryptocurrency, stocks, bonds, mutual funds, and savings accounts may also be considered for qualification.
- Personalized solutions: Because you work directly with the lender, you can negotiate lower down payments or more favorable interest rates.
Portfolio loans bespoke financing options designed to fit your needs. It gives you more flexibility than traditional loans and works particularly well for high-net-worth individuals with diversified wealth across various investments and businesses.
Interest-only mortgages: Pay less now, plan for later
Looking for lower monthly payments, especially in the early years of your mortgage? An interest-only mortgage could be a good option. With this type of loan, you only pay the interest for a set period—typically between 5 and 10 years—before starting to pay off the principal. This approach works well if you’re trying to minimize your initial out-of-pocket expenses, particularly if you’re looking to invest elsewhere.
In an interest-only mortgage, your monthly payments will be significantly lower during the interest-only period, allowing you to use the money for other investments or financial obligations. This could be particularly beneficial if you invest in other ventures, such as starting or growing a business, expanding your investment portfolio, or even making home improvements.
Here are the main things to consider with interest-only mortgages:
- Lower payments early on: You’ll only pay the interest for the first few years, freeing up cash for other investments. This can give you some financial breathing room while your income grows or you wait for other investments to pay off.
- Flexible timing: This type of loan is ideal for individuals anticipating a future increase in income or planning to sell or refinance before the principal payments begin. If you’re confident your home’s value will appreciate, you can sell the property before facing higher payments.
- Larger payments later: Once the interest-only period ends, your payments will increase as you start paying off the principal, so make sure to plan for this. Without careful planning, the increased costs could strain your finances, so it’s crucial to understand the terms and have a strategy in place.
An interest-only mortgage is a smart way to manage cash flow while acquiring a high-value property. However, make sure to have a clear plan for what happens once the interest-only period ends.
Asset-based lending: Use wealth to build wealth
Asset-based lending allows you to use your existing investments, such as stocks or bonds, as collateral for your mortgage. It can be an excellent way for high-net-worth individuals to secure financing without tapping into their income or selling off valuable assets.
Rather than selling your assets to finance a luxury home, you can leverage them as collateral to secure a loan. This allows your investments to keep growing while simultaneously enabling you to purchase high-end real estate.
Here are the main benefits of asset-based lending:
- No need for income verification: If your income fluctuates or doesn’t fit the standard mold, asset-based lending focuses on your wealth, not your paycheck.
- Keep your investments growing: You don’t have to sell off stocks or other assets, allowing them to appreciate while serving as security for the loan. This way, you can preserve your investment strategy while securing the funds needed for your home.
- Flexible loan amounts: The loan is based on the value of your assets, giving you more flexibility in how much you borrow. For example, suppose your assets are valued at $10 million. In that case, a lender might offer you a loan for up to 75% of their value, giving you a significant loan amount without liquidating your assets.
This strategy is ideal for buyers with significant assets who prefer to keep them growing rather than liquidating them to fund a property purchase. It offers a win-win: your investments continue generating returns while you secure the financing you need.
Bridge loans: The fast track to your next home
Bridge loans can be a game-changer when you’re buying a new home while selling your current one. In the fast-paced Pacific Palisades luxury homes market, waiting for your existing home to sell before closing on another property might mean missing out on the perfect opportunity. A bridge loan allows you to act quickly and without delay.
A bridge loan is a short term loan that typically needs to be repaid within 6 months to around three years. It provides temporary financing, giving you the funding you need to secure a new home before your current home is sold. Once your existing home sells, you can use the proceeds to pay off the bridge loan.
Here are a few things to know:
- Quick access to funds: A bridge loan can be secured quickly, giving you the ability to move swiftly in a competitive market.
- Short-term solution: Bridge loans are flexible, short-term options to cover the gap between buying and selling.
- Higher interest rates: Because they’re short-term loans, bridge loans tend to have higher interest rates, but their flexibility can be worth it. If you’re confident that your current home will sell quickly, the convenience of a bridge loan can far outweigh the cost.
A bridge loan is a great way to secure your next home without rushing the sale of your existing one, giving you peace of mind and more control over the process.
GET READY TO SECURE YOUR LUXURY HOME LOAN
Financing a luxury home differs significantly from obtaining a standard mortgage—it demands more careful planning and preparation. Whether you’re purchasing a primary residence or a second home, staying organized and understanding what lenders prioritize can be crucial in securing the best terms.
Here are some essential tips on how to prepare for a mortgage acquisition:
- Check your credit score and financial health
Even with significant assets, your credit score remains a key factor in securing financing. Given the substantial investment a luxury home represents, lenders want to ensure you can repay the loan on time. To qualify for the best rates, you’ll need to demonstrate a strong credit history, typically requiring a score of 700 or higher.
Review your credit score early and identify areas for improvement. Obtain your credit report in advance, carefully checking for any errors or issues that could be lowering your score, and address them promptly. Where possible, pay down existing debt and avoid opening new credit accounts in the months leading up to your loan application.
- Gather your financial documents
Most likely, obtaining financing for a Pacific Palisades luxury home requires more extensive documentation than conventional loans. Lenders will need a detailed look at your financial history, including your income, assets, and other investments.
Collect at least two years’ worth of tax returns, recent bank and investment statements, and any documentation proving your business income or other revenue streams. The more organized you are, the smoother the process will be.
- Decide on your down payment
Lenders typically require a minimum down payment of 20% for most luxury homes in Pacific Palisades. A larger down payment not only increases your chances of securing a favorable loan but also lowers your monthly payments. However, it’s important not to deplete all your liquid assets.
Be strategic with your down payment. While a higher upfront investment can improve your loan terms, it’s essential to retain enough liquidity for future investments or unexpected expenses. Balancing both will set you up for financial flexibility down the road.
- Figure out which assets to use
High-net-worth individuals often have diverse portfolios, and deciding which assets you want to leverage for your home financing is essential. Lenders may be willing to accept a wide range of assets as collateral, such as stocks, bonds, or even business holdings.
Work with your financial advisor to determine which assets you should leverage for a loan. Find ways to keep the rest of your portfolio working for you while using a portion to secure the best financing terms.
- Get pre-approved
Pre-approval can give you a significant advantage in competitive luxury markets like Pacific Palisades. It shows sellers you’re serious and have the financial backing to follow through on the purchase.
The approval process for a luxury home mortgage typically takes longer than for a conventional loan due to the additional documentation required during underwriting. To ensure you’re ready to act quickly when you find the perfect property, it’s wise to begin the pre-approval process early. Pre-approval also provides a clear understanding of your borrowing capacity, helping you navigate the market with confidence.
AVOID THESE FINANCING PITFALLS
When it comes to financing a luxury property, even the most financially savvy buyers can encounter common pitfalls. High-end-real estate financing often involves larger sums, more complex structures, and unique considerations. But knowing the potential challenges ahead of time can help you sidestep these and make smarter decisions.
- Over-leveraging
While qualifying for a large loan can be tempting, it doesn’t always mean you should maximize your borrowing power. Over-leveraging occurs when you take on more debt than you can comfortably manage. Even with a strong financial foundation, unexpected market shifts or personal expenses could leave you stretched thin.
Ensure your mortgage payments are sustainable alongside your other financial obligations. Take into account your overall lifestyle, ongoing investments, and the need for financial flexibility in the future. Planning wisely now will help you avoid unnecessary financial strain down the road.
- Ignoring interest rate fluctuations or higher future payments
Adjustable-rate mortgages (ARMs) can be appealing due to the initially low interest rates, but they come with the risk of rising rates over time. Without proper planning, you could face significantly higher monthly payments than expected.
If you opt for an ARM, have a clear strategy in place on what to do if interest rates increase. Alternatively, consider locking in a fixed-rate loan to enjoy the stability of consistent payments.
Similarly, If you choose an interest-only loan, have a clear plan on how to address larger payments down the road, whether it involves refinancing, selling, or making sure you have the financial means to handle the higher costs.
- Underestimating hidden costs
A luxury home often comes with more than just a significant price tag. Expenses associated with owning a home such as property taxes, insurance, maintenance, and homeowners’ association fees can all add up quickly, and and these expenses tend to be significantly higher for upscale properties
Plan for more than just the mortgage. Consider the full range of costs of owning a luxury home so there are no surprises once you’re settled in.
- Forgetting your long-term financial goals
Financing a high end property should be part of your overall financial strategy, not just a standalone decision. It’s easy to get swept up in the excitement of buying a beautiful new home, but you should always consider how this aligns with your long-term wealth management plan.
Before making any decisions, it’s wise to consult a financial advisor to ensure your financing plan supports your broader financial goals. Whether for tax efficiency or to keep your investment strategy intact, taking a holistic approach will help you maximize the benefits of your luxury home purchase.
